#5b89b1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5b89b1 is composed of 35.7% red, 53.7% green and 69.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.6% cyan, 22.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 207.9 degrees, a saturation of 35.5% and a lightness of 52.5%. #5b89b1 color hex could be obtained by blending #b6ffff with #001363.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#5b89b1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040709 is the darkest color, while #fbfc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#5b89b1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#80868c is the less saturated color, while #118efb is the most saturated one.
